There are a few guns I've been looking for, and yesterday I found them. I rarely go in this place because they won't take less than the price on the tag. The guy had a like new 20 gauge 870 Magnum LW, a 20 gauge Wingmaster LW, a stainless 700ML, a nice 760 in .30-06, a 552 Speedmaster, and several Model 700s.  I went back today and got the 20 gauge Magnum 870 Wingmaster and put a deposit on the 552.

This is the nicest 870 I've ever owned.

i found one of those 870 LW wingmasters a few years ago at Gander for $275.  sweet little guns.  mine was made in '73 and has the mahogany stocks.  the only downside is its fixed modified and i would have preferred the remchokes. 

you will love that little gun.  quick to the shoulder and hits what you shoot at.  i shoot trap with it and its almost boring.
